Indicators replacement may be needed:
  • Increased stopping distance
  • Excessive brake noise
  • Abnormal brake pedal feel
  • Pulling or vibration during braking
  • Excessive brake dust on wheels

How Often Should You Have a Brake Inspection

Generally, you should have your brakes inspected by a professional every six months. You should also schedule an inspection as soon as you notice anything unusual about your vehicle’s braking performance.

How Often Should You Replace Your Brake Pads

How often you actually need Toyota brake repair in Pueblo depends on a number of factors. It depends on the model, and the guidelines for Toyota vehicles range from 30,000 to 70,000 miles. It also depends on your usage and driving habits. Some drivers are harder on their brakes than others. Driving conditions matter too. If you drive home from work in stop-and-go traffic, you’ll probably have to change your pads more than the driver who does not.

What Are the Signs That Your Brakes Are Going Bad

Brake problems will usually manifest in unusual noises. They can also change the way the vehicle feels. Our Toyota service team serving Pueblo Florence Penrose Canon City advise not ignoring: High-pitched squealing, Pulsations in the pedal, Steering wheel vibrations, Grinding noises or a hard growl, Squeaking when you come to a stop, Low initial brake bite when applying pressure.

What Happens If You Drive on Bad Brakes

Be mindful that brake problems aren’t going to go away on their own and will worsen with time. If you keep driving on brake pads that are worn down, you’re eventually going to damage the rotor and other aspects of your brake system, and then, that Toyota brake repair in Pueblo is going to become much more expensive. Of course, the risks aren’t just financial. Poor brake performance means that it takes a longer distance and more time for your vehicle to come to a stop. In addition, there are those other issues we mentioned earlier, and that can lead to poor handling as well.
